?This is a Push-Button type switch that has 4 terminals, 2 internal and 2 external. This genuine Makita replacement part is sold individually. rnrnSwitches are commonly replaced parts in tools. A switch handles on/off and variable speed operations. They also have a role in electric breaking; they can momentarily reverse electrical polarity. Because switches use mechanical internals, they will degrade and wear out over time, eventually needing replacement. Some common signs of a broken or failing switch are as follows: • The tool has completely stopped functioning - it will not start. • The tool operates intermittently, requiring multiple tries to turn on, until eventually it won't start at all. • The variable speed function and electric braking aren't working properly.

Switch defective, intermittent
Mark from DALLAS, Texas
- Difficulty Level:
- A Bit Difficult
- Total Repair Time:
- Less than 15 mins
- Tools:
- Pliers, Screw drivers
1. Removed two screws from base housing and remove both halves of housing.
2. Disconnected two push connections from base of switch.
3. Pushed switch partially out of housing to expose Phillips head screws.
4. Removed two Phillips head screws to release switch wires.
5. Remove switch.
... Read more />6. Replaced switch, reconnecting wires to Phillips head screws, positioning with pliers.
7. Reseat switch in housing completely.
8. Reattach wires with push on clips with pliers.
9. Tug on each wire to verify attachment. (Tuck away extra wire lead to facilitate reattachment of housing.)
Brush Replacement
1. Move brush retainer spring to the side gently with pliers. Do not pull out spring.
2. Disconnect push on connector at end of braided wire pigtail on brush. (View replacement brush for construction visual, if necessary.)
3. Remove old brush. ( Look for pitting, scoring or chips on brush. Remove all pieces if broken. This is also an opportunity to view condition of commutator plates on armature through brush pocket.)
4. Insert new brush, noting orientation of connection pigtail.
5. Reconnect push on clip at end of pigtail with needlenose pliers.
6. Replace retaining spring gently on top of new brush.
7. Tuck away braided pigtail.
8. Repeat process with second brush.
9. Replace lower housing cover side, making sure wires are positioned out of the way and housing half seats fully with no resistance.
10. Replace second housing half, aligning screw holes while listening for an audible snap when halves mate.
11. Reinsert and tighten screws.
12. Plug in and test unit for function.

https://youtu.be/meFXCaWystw
This video clearly shows all the steps and made me confident that if I ordered the part, the fix would be pretty easy. It was exactly the same model of Makita grinder and well explained. I had a little bit of trouble fitting t ... Read more he two halves if the black plastic housing back - there are some channels that the wires need to be pushed into to make them fit snugly and not get in the way of joining the two parts back together. But that that just took a little care and patience. The grinder works like new now.
